Click-Select in time ruler (rant)


Recommended Posts

I really REALLY wish the only way to select anything by clicking in the time line ruler is by click+drag. I seem to be forever accidently clicking and selecting a vast chunk of project. Once it is selected, you can't unselect it with a mouse action without moving the Now time.

I'm forever searching for Ctrl-Shift-A on the keyboard to un-select.

2 minutes ago, scook said:

Try CTRL+click in an empty part of a track or take lane

Interesting. Doesn't work in the PRV; or in "blank/unused space" in the track view, but does indeed work on existing tracks/lanes. Good to know. I don't feel that it resolves my irritation at the behavior, though. Thanks.

4 hours ago, Billy86 said:

So you mapped CTRL-SHIFT A to the ‘~’ key, correct? Have been fighting this issue as well. 

I just checked, and, to be completely accurate, in Preferences < Keyboard Shortcuts, I mapped the `-key (accent) to Edit | Select | None in Global Bindings.

I mean, it is the ~ tilda key also, but in key bindings it shows up as `.

On 1/8/2022 at 9:07 AM, Jeremy Murray-Wakefield said:

Another option is to deselect "Left Click Sets Now" and get into the habit of only clicking on the ruler when you want to set the NOW time:

image.png.339a1695d39b87a737470d926fed3d61.png

I deselected "Left Click Sets Now" and selected "Right Click Sets Now." It's awkward and I'm still getting used to it but so far it seems to be helping me make selections without changing the Now time.
